What is the Capsular Pattern of Glenohumeral Joint?
The capsular pattern describes a specific limitation in movement typical of injuries or conditions affecting the glenohumeral joint. When pathology occurs in this joint, it manifests through characteristic restrictions in shoulder range of motion.
Characteristics of the Capsular Pattern
The capsular pattern for the glenohumeral joint typically results in the following order of limitations:
- External rotation - This is usually the most restricted motion.
- Abduction - This follows external rotation in terms of restriction.
- Internal rotation - This is often the least restricted, particularly when compared to external rotation.
Understanding Glenohumeral Joint Anatomy
To fully appreciate the capsular pattern of glenohumeral joint, it's essential to understand its anatomy. The glenohumeral joint is a ball-and-socket joint comprising:
- Glenoid Cavity: The shallow socket of the shoulder blade.
- Humeral Head: The rounded end of the upper arm bone that fits into the glenoid cavity.
- Labrum: The cartilage that surrounds the glenoid cavity, deepening the socket.
- Capsule: The connective tissue that encases the joint.
- Ligaments: These stabilize the shoulder and connect bones.
Significance of the Capsular Pattern in Diagnosis
The identification of the capsular pattern of glenohumeral joint plays a vital role in diagnosing shoulder injuries and conditions, such as:
- Adhesive Capsulitis (Frozen Shoulder): A condition characterized by stiffness and pain in the shoulder joint.
- Rotator Cuff Injuries: Tears or inflammation can result in characteristic movement restrictions.
- Osteoarthritis: Progressive degeneration of joint cartilage affecting motion patterns.
Evaluating Glenohumeral Joint Mobility
Assessment should focus on evaluating active and passive ranges of motion. A physical therapist or chiropractor will typically perform the following evaluations:
- Active Range of Motion: The patient moves their shoulder without assistance.
- Passive Range of Motion: The practitioner moves the patient's shoulder to assess joint movement capabilities.
- Special Tests: Diagnostic techniques aimed at pinpointing specific injuries or conditions, such as the Hawkins-Kennedy test for impingement.
Rehabilitation and Management of Glenohumeral Joint Conditions
Understanding the capsular pattern informs treatment strategies by allowing healthcare providers to devise effective rehabilitation protocols. Some standard approaches for managing shoulder conditions include:
1. Physical Therapy
Targeting the specific range of motion limitations is essential. A tailored therapy program may include:
- Stretching Exercises: To improve flexibility in the affected range of motion.
- Strengthening Exercises: Focused on the rotator cuff and stabilizing muscles to support joint integrity.
- Manual Therapy: Techniques that address tissue restrictions and improve joint mobility.
2. Chiropractic Care
Chiropractors can play an integral role in managing the capsular pattern of glenohumeral joint issues through:
- Adjustments: To help realign the joint and surrounding structures.
- Soft Tissue Techniques: To alleviate tension and improve overall function.
- Education: Guiding patients on proper movement patterns and ergonomics to prevent further injury.
3. Surgical Intervention
In certain cases, conservative treatments may not yield the desired results, leading to the need for surgical options:
- Arthroscopic Surgery: Minimally invasive technique to address specific injuries.
- Shoulder Replacement: For severe conditions affecting joint integrity.
